Transaction 7505f4ea26ed1d0607823fca0d5ecf70f89d2c3034bc98def64fbccaa129a8fd

1 Input
2 Outputs
  • 7505f4ea26ed1d0607823fca0d5ecf70f89d2c3034bc98def64fbccaa129a8fd:0
  • value  26440
    address  121VCHJTKK2m6G3DRyyAU4aNKKkwi3uehJ
  • 7505f4ea26ed1d0607823fca0d5ecf70f89d2c3034bc98def64fbccaa129a8fd:1
  • value  300695
    address  1Bd7RjdHiaPEhFQRXUJHohhX1tq3sMVQHh